Weather Tower & Environmental Station

Module: Studio Structure

Semester: SS19

Team: Ilina Polihronova & Alisa Fainberg

In the vicinity of the city of Weingarten (Baden) are first built a weather tower with measuring instruments on the roof and later next to it an environmental station, where the measured data can be processed. The two buildings are designed not only for the use of scientists and employees, but they are planned as an interesting and suitable place for visitors.

The construction of the weather tower is made of brick walls with reinforced concrete platforms and stairs. The tower looks light and open and serves not only for better positioning the weather measuring devices on top of it, but offers a 360-degree panoramic walk with magnificent views of the city and nature from above.

Right next to it is the environmental station, which is designed as a wooden skeleton structure and has offices for the staff working there as well as a café available for the public. The station has a spacious terrace, along which are several wide steps suitable for seating, from which visitors can enjoy the beautiful view of the city.

Home Sweet Home (Office)

Module: Studio Context

Semester: WS20/21

Team: Ilina Polihronova, Nicola Marquaß & Marcel Erdmann

Taking inspiration from Heidelberg’s name and its picturesque mountainous surroundings, the structure is thoughtfully crafted to emulate the undulating terrain, with a primary objective of seamlessly merging the natural landscape with the urban setting.

The architectural concept of the building embraces a stepped design, strategically aligned with the path of the sun, to optimize the infusion of natural light into the living spaces within the apartments.

Internally, the building accommodates a diverse range of spaces, including offices, co-working areas, residential areas, a boarding house, and a restaurant. The structure is composed of two subterranean levels, constructed with reinforced concrete to serve as parking facilities. Above ground, there are eight floors, constructed using robust solid wooden walls (Holz100 elements).

Death in the Age of Immortality

Module: Bachelor Thesis

Semester: WS21/22

Team: Ilina Polihronova

With the harmonious connection of the three thematic strands - science, logistics and ritual, the purpose of the building is to show through architecture and the space program that death does not always mean the end.

The main concept is to extend the existing wall of the cemetery and in this way define the building and its courtyard as a new part of the cemetery park. The aim is to create a quiet and harmonious park, protected from the harsh and noisy urban environment. This was achieved by enclosing the site with a wall similar in material to the cemetery wall, but with the function of a weather-protected columbarium.

The building itself consists of three floors and five entrances. The construction on the ground floor and first floor consists of solid wooden walls (Holz100 elements) and wooden columns in combination with glass elements and in the basement of reinforced concrete with an exposed concrete look.
